Mainframe Application Developer Apprenticeship

The main technologies you will focus on are:

Mainframe, COBOL, JCL, zDevOps, Z/OS, PL/1, IMS, DB2.

The program involves:

  • Classroom and on the job training on Z/OS Mainframe.
  • Classroom and on the job training in COBOL and/or PL/1.
  • Classroom and on the job training in DB2.
  • Classroom and on the job training in ISPF, zDevOps, IMS and other Mainframe tools.
  • Significant hands-on training and work experience in real world Enterprise environments.
  • Solving real world technical issues learning to troubleshoot and problem solve.

Program participants will join multi-functional operations teams to gain valuable experience in a large Mainframe distributed environment.

Team members will work with diverse business units right across General Motors.
